Sona Nanotech's Tumor Priming Data Suggests Immunotherapy Synergies in Melanoma
Event summary
- Histology analysis from Sona’s first-in-human study showed innate immune activation with natural killer cell infiltration post-THT treatment.
- Partially responding patients exhibited increased T-regulatory cells and PD-L1 expression, suggesting potential for combination therapy with PD-1 immunotherapy.
- 8 out of 10 late-stage melanoma patients responded to THT, with 6 showing no detectable residual melanoma by day 15.
- Results are being prepared for peer-reviewed journal submission.
The big picture
Sona’s data suggests a potential breakthrough in overcoming immunotherapy resistance, addressing a critical gap for late-stage cancer patients. If validated, this could position THT as a key adjunct therapy in oncology, particularly for cancers with historically low response rates to immunotherapies like colorectal cancer.
